  • Applications

    N-methylpentylamine is a secondary aliphatic amine primarily used as an organic synthesis intermediate and building block for higher-value chemicals. In industry, it is commonly employed as a precursor to amines and amides, supporting routes to pharmaceutical and agrochemical intermediates. It can also serve as a precursor to quaternary ammonium salts for surfactants and phase-transfer catalysts, and may act as a reactive component or curing agent in epoxy resin systems used in coatings and adhesives. Additionally, it can function as a precursor for ligands or catalyst components in metal-catalyzed processes. All uses are subject to local regulations and formulation limits.
